## Deploying the Gatewick Proctor Queue

Deploys are pretty painless: push to main, wait for the pipeline, then watch the queue drain dashboard for five minutes. If candidates pile up mid-exam, roll back first and ask questions later — the queue replays safely. Everything the workers care about lives in one config block, shown here for reference.

settings of bafof-yagef:
JOROX_PIN=8740
JOROX_TENANT=pelox
JOROX_METRICS_HOST=metrics.jorox.qorvelworks.internal
JOROX_SEAL=seal_c78f63c1
JOROX_STANDBY_TEAM=norax

TURN-208: Gatevale turnstile counters at the Merrow Field pilot double-count when a rotation reverses mid-cycle. Attendance totals drift roughly 2% high per event. The debounce window fix is implemented, reviewed by Ilsa, and soak-tested across two simulated match days without drift. Ready for your cut; the candidate build is identified below.

trace token, tagag-tafog: htk6_5ed18c

09:05 — Support flagged autocomplete latency above 4s on Quillbrook search. 09:18 — On-call confirmed the suggestion index on the Harlow shard had not compacted for six days. 09:33 — Manual compaction started; latency fell to 300ms by 09:52. 10:10 — Root cause: the compaction cron was disabled during last week's Tessary migration and never re-enabled. Customers may mention slow typeahead from the prior two days; no data was lost. For escalations, reference the build identifier noted directly below this entry.

trace token, fafog-kageg: htk4_98e6

## Runbook: Shrinkray batch resize CLI

Shrinkray resizes image batches from the ingest bucket. Runs under the low-privilege worker account; no shell-out, no network egress except the store. Job state and dedupe hashes live in a dedicated database. Security note: credentials are scoped read-write to that schema only. To audit job records, connect using the connection string below.

warehouse DSN: mssql://rusdor_svc:0FSWCn9@db-951a.paliqforge.local:5432/ulawyn

**09:17** — The Pinloft alert deduplicator began collapsing unrelated pages into a single incident after a hashing change merged without review of the key fields. Reviewers should confirm that dedup keys include the service label going forward. We rolled back within eleven minutes. The offending deployment is identified by the build token below.

pipeline stamp: htk9_6ce9d33c5